From source file:com.example.artest.SimpleRenderer.java
/** * Override the draw function from ARRenderer. *///from w ww . j av a 2 s. c o m @Override public void draw(GL10 gl) { gl.glClear(GL10.GL_COLOR_BUFFER_BIT | GL10.GL_DEPTH_BUFFER_BIT); // Apply the ARToolKit projection matrix gl.glMatrixMode(GL10.GL_PROJECTION); gl.glLoadMatrixf(ARToolKit.getInstance().getProjectionMatrix(), 0); gl.glEnable(GL10.GL_CULL_FACE); gl.glShadeModel(GL10.GL_SMOOTH); gl.glEnable(GL10.GL_DEPTH_TEST); gl.glFrontFace(GL10.GL_CW); // If the marker is visible, apply its transformation, and draw a cube for (int i = 0; i < markerIDs.length; i++) { if (ARToolKit.getInstance().queryMarkerVisible(markerIDs[i])) { gl.glMatrixMode(GL10.GL_MODELVIEW); gl.glLoadMatrixf(ARToolKit.getInstance().queryMarkerTransformation(markerIDs[i]), 0); cube[i].draw(gl); markerVisible[i] = true; } else { markerVisible[i] = false; } } }
